10396571
0x263ef3a17ade598e1c6a6dcade4664d2a1d68bd08b1f5c8bdb54e77975e6bbc0
Transactions0
Height10396571
Confirmations3222685
Timestamp273 days 11 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xf104cc58d5e0cd79
Bits
Difficulty0x2e95f96b